What companies run services between Bank Negara, Malaysia and Kajang, Malaysia?

KTM Komuter operates a train from Bank Negara to Kajang 4 times a day. Tickets cost RM 7–11 and the journey takes 48 min. Alternatively, Rapid KL operates a bus from (M) Kl101 Hub Lebuh Pudu to Kj643 Kajang Plaza Medical Centre hourly. Tickets cost RM 1–5 and the journey takes 1h.
